Behind the label: Saymyname

Marisa Cannon

Who started it? A graduate of the Moda Gudi School in Porto, Portugal, Catarina Cerqueira began her career with French brands Lady Soul and Homecore. After a stint as creative assistant to fellow Portuguese designer Luis Buchinho, in 2007, she launched Saymyname – an homage to art, culture and experimentation.

Why we love it: inspired by cultural motifs, Saymyname’s designs are eccentric but also stylish and wearable. Ethnic influences and relaxed cuts make up the label’s most recent offerings, and Cerqueira channels her latest influence – Islamic sufis – through statement wraps, linen jackets and draped skirts. Turquoise metallic fabrics feature as lively counterparts to flowing pastel jumpsuits, all of which make for wonderful summer wear.
